Basic Function

To plan, manage, and oversee operations of a very large and complex group of facilities. Reports to designated supervisor.

Examples Of Duties

Additional Basic Function – if applicable:

Duties/essential functions may include, but not be limited to, the following:

Plan and direct operations of multiple facilities; develop policies and procedures related to facility operations.

Coordinate upkeep and preventative maintenance of assigned facilities; oversee custodial and maintenance functions; oversee personnel administration; participate in labor relations activities.

Plan, oversee, and coordinate major renovation, construction, and repair projects.

Manage budget for multiple facilities which may include capital budget management; participate in department planning and budget projections and implementation.

Oversee equipment and supply purchasing; ensure equipment is maintained and in proper working condition; supervise inventory system.

Manage and maintain building security; report safety and security problems to appropriate authority; coordinate risk management procedures for facility.

Serve on various department, division, and University committees.

Fulfill responsibilities of human resource management including equal opportunity and employee development.

Provide leadership of a small department, unit, or major function and/or direct supervision over administrative/professional employees.

Perform related duties as assigned.

Positions assigned to the Stark Campus or College of Podiatriic Medicine may be responsible for:

Oversight and coordination of facility design, utility engineering, real estate, maintenance, grounds, and operations.

Direct and manage media services, parking, dining, and fleet services.

Serve as liaison with Stark State College on shared facility, land use, security, communications and planning.

Assume responsibility for campus land, land use, campus tree inventory, and related issues (e.g., Pro Football Hall of Fame, Balloon Classic, etc.).

Assume responsibility for maximizing efficiency of space utilization (e.g., classroom scheduling, office allocation, building usage, etc.).

Improve efficiency and ensure that facilities meet environmental, health, and security standards and comply with government regulations.

Coordinate and participate in architectural and engineering planning and design, including campus master planning, facilities planning, space and installation management.

Provide advice or direction to project planner on support services capabilities.

Manage administrative matters regarding day-to-day operations and procedures including staffing and review of departmental effectiveness, policy, and procedures.

Develop, manage, and continuously improve practices and programs around campus safety, emergency preparedness, and response. Analyze plan and implement process redesign and other transaction changes to improve efficiency and effectiveness.

Provide on-site management support for community special events.

Coordinate campus sustainability efforts.

Minimum Qualifications

Additional Examples of Duties – if applicable:

Bachelor's degree in a relevant field; four years progressively responsible experience in large-scale facilities management, including prior supervisory/management experience.

OR

Associate's degree in a relevant field; six years progressively responsible experience in large-scale facilities management, including prior supervisor/management experience.

License/Certification

Knowledge Of:

Business and management principles relative to strategic planning, resource allocation, human resources management, and the coordination of people and resources.

Contract principles, applicable laws, and regulations.

Skill In

Written and verbal communication and interpersonal skills

Ability To

Communication effectively orally and in writing.

Work effectively with university staff, workers, vendors, and external constituents.

Supervise, plan, and coordinate and ability to meet deadlines.

Provide leadership and direction.
